Overview

UNS S40900 is a low-chromium, titanium-stabilized ferritic stainless steel renowned for its excellent cost-performance ratio and reliable high-temperature oxidation resistance. As a ferritic grade, it exhibits magnetic properties and good thermal conductivity, distinguishing itself from austenitic stainless steels. The titanium addition stabilizes the alloy, preventing intergranular corrosion and enhancing weldability, making it easy to fabricate via cutting, forming, and welding processes. It is primarily designed for applications requiring moderate corrosion protection and high-temperature stability, serving as a cost-effective solution in automotive and general industrial fields where budget and basic performance are key considerations.

Chemical Composition (wt%)

C ≤ 0.08, Cr: 10.50-11.75, Ti: 0.15-0.35, Mn ≤ 1.00, Si ≤ 1.00, P ≤ 0.045, S ≤ 0.030, Ni ≤ 0.50, N ≤ 0.030

Typical Mechanical Properties (Annealed Condition)

Tensile Strength (Rm): ≥ 448 MPa; Yield Strength (Rp0.2): ≥ 238 MPa; Elongation (A): ≥ 33%; Brinell Hardness (HB): ≤ 183

Core Advantages

Cost-effective with moderate corrosion resistance; titanium stabilization prevents intergranular corrosion and improves weldability; excellent high-temperature oxidation resistance (up to 760°C); good formability similar to carbon steel; magnetic with high thermal conductivity; suitable for mass production with low material costs.

Applications

Automotive exhaust systems (manifolds, mufflers, tailpipes, catalytic converters), home heating systems, heat exchanger tubing, electrical transformer cases, architectural trim, and general industrial components in mild corrosive environments.

Equivalent Grades

EN 1.4512, AISI 409, GB 022Cr11Ti, SUS409L
